Any good chick starter feed is perfectly adequate for birds that will hopefully make exhibition specimens, LF or bantams

Gamebird feed does not have the correct nutrition profile for chickens and the excessive protein is a waste at best. Commercial chick starter feeds are formulated for meat chickens whose dietary needs are much greater than any prospective show chicken.
